The Timloc Interlocking Plain Roof Tile Vent is an outstanding tile vent that offers attic ventilation and prevents general roofing condensation; alternatively, you can connect an adaptor to the tile vent and use it to connect mechanical extraction or soil ventilation.
Free ventilation area of 6,000m²
Shaped to prevent rainwater from entering and causing structural damage
4mm spaced external grille helps prevent rainwater and even small critters, vermin and debris.
Integrated clips to ensure a secure fit to surrounding roof tiles
UV Stabilised, top of the vent, offering resistance to discolouration
Manufactured from polypropylene enabling it to be resistant to corrosion
The Timloc Interlocking Plain Roof Tile Vent is manufactured from naturally lightweight polypropylene, with the top side coated with a UV stabiliser, providing a product that is resistant to decay and discolouration.
It has achieved various standards and regulations, some of which include;
BS EN 490:2011 (+A1:2017)
BS 5250:2021
BS 5534:2014 (+A2:2018)
BS EN ISO 9001:2015
BS EN ISO 14001:2015
All relevant Building Regulations 2010
All relevant NHBC requirements
